Package com.powsybl.entsoe.util
Class MergedXnodeImpl
- java.lang.Object
-
- com.powsybl.commons.extensions.AbstractExtension<Line>
-
- com.powsybl.entsoe.util.MergedXnodeImpl
-
- All Implemented Interfaces:
Extension<Line>
,MergedXnode
public class MergedXnodeImpl extends AbstractExtension<Line> implements MergedXnode
- Author:
- Jérémy Labous
-
-
Constructor Summary
Constructors Constructor Description MergedXnodeImpl(Line line, double rdp, double xdp, double xnodeP1, double xnodeQ1, double xnodeP2, double xnodeQ2, String line1Name, String line2Name, String code)
MergedXnodeImpl(Line line, double rdp, double xdp, String line1Name, boolean line1Fictitious, double xnodeP1, double xnodeQ1, double b1dp, double g1dp, String line2Name, boolean line2Fictitious, double xnodeP2, double xnodeQ2, double b2dp, double g2dp, String code)
-
Method Summary
-
Methods inherited from class com.powsybl.commons.extensions.AbstractExtension
getExtendable, setExtendable
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.powsybl.commons.extensions.Extension
getExtendable, setExtendable
-
Methods inherited from interface com.powsybl.entsoe.util.MergedXnode
getName
-
-
-
-
Method Detail
-
getRdp
public double getRdp()
- Specified by:
getRdp
in interfaceMergedXnode
-
setRdp
public MergedXnodeImpl setRdp(double rdp)
- Specified by:
setRdp
in interfaceMergedXnode
-
getXdp
public double getXdp()
- Specified by:
getXdp
in interfaceMergedXnode
-
setXdp
public MergedXnodeImpl setXdp(double xdp)
- Specified by:
setXdp
in interfaceMergedXnode
-
getLine1Name
public String getLine1Name()
- Specified by:
getLine1Name
in interfaceMergedXnode
-
setLine1Name
public MergedXnodeImpl setLine1Name(String line1Name)
- Specified by:
setLine1Name
in interfaceMergedXnode
-
isLine1Fictitious
public boolean isLine1Fictitious()
- Specified by:
isLine1Fictitious
in interfaceMergedXnode
-
setLine1Fictitious
public MergedXnodeImpl setLine1Fictitious(boolean line1Fictitious)
- Specified by:
setLine1Fictitious
in interfaceMergedXnode
-
getXnodeP1
public double getXnodeP1()
- Specified by:
getXnodeP1
in interfaceMergedXnode
-
setXnodeP1
public MergedXnodeImpl setXnodeP1(double xnodeP1)
- Specified by:
setXnodeP1
in interfaceMergedXnode
-
getXnodeQ1
public double getXnodeQ1()
- Specified by:
getXnodeQ1
in interfaceMergedXnode
-
setXnodeQ1
public MergedXnodeImpl setXnodeQ1(double xnodeQ1)
- Specified by:
setXnodeQ1
in interfaceMergedXnode
-
setB1dp
public MergedXnodeImpl setB1dp(double b1dp)
- Specified by:
setB1dp
in interfaceMergedXnode
-
getB1dp
public double getB1dp()
- Specified by:
getB1dp
in interfaceMergedXnode
-
setG1dp
public MergedXnodeImpl setG1dp(double g1dp)
- Specified by:
setG1dp
in interfaceMergedXnode
-
getG1dp
public double getG1dp()
- Specified by:
getG1dp
in interfaceMergedXnode
-
getLine2Name
public String getLine2Name()
- Specified by:
getLine2Name
in interfaceMergedXnode
-
setLine2Name
public MergedXnodeImpl setLine2Name(String line2Name)
- Specified by:
setLine2Name
in interfaceMergedXnode
-
isLine2Fictitious
public boolean isLine2Fictitious()
- Specified by:
isLine2Fictitious
in interfaceMergedXnode
-
setLine2Fictitious
public MergedXnodeImpl setLine2Fictitious(boolean line2Fictitious)
- Specified by:
setLine2Fictitious
in interfaceMergedXnode
-
getXnodeP2
public double getXnodeP2()
- Specified by:
getXnodeP2
in interfaceMergedXnode
-
setXnodeP2
public MergedXnodeImpl setXnodeP2(double xnodeP2)
- Specified by:
setXnodeP2
in interfaceMergedXnode
-
getXnodeQ2
public double getXnodeQ2()
- Specified by:
getXnodeQ2
in interfaceMergedXnode
-
setXnodeQ2
public MergedXnodeImpl setXnodeQ2(double xnodeQ2)
- Specified by:
setXnodeQ2
in interfaceMergedXnode
-
setB2dp
public MergedXnodeImpl setB2dp(double b2dp)
- Specified by:
setB2dp
in interfaceMergedXnode
-
getB2dp
public double getB2dp()
- Specified by:
getB2dp
in interfaceMergedXnode
-
setG2dp
public MergedXnodeImpl setG2dp(double g2dp)
- Specified by:
setG2dp
in interfaceMergedXnode
-
getG2dp
public double getG2dp()
- Specified by:
getG2dp
in interfaceMergedXnode
-
getCode
public String getCode()
- Specified by:
getCode
in interfaceMergedXnode
-
setCode
public MergedXnodeImpl setCode(String code)
- Specified by:
setCode
in interfaceMergedXnode
-
-